Eileen Delgado
Eileen Delgado (Choreography) has choreographed a multitude of shows at the Heights since 1973 including George M!, 42nd Street, Mame, La Cage Aux Folles, Call Me Madam, Sweet Charity, Funny Girl and A Funny Thing Happened On The Way To The Forum to name a few. She has also served as photographer on several productions.

About The Heights Players

The Heights Players is Brooklyn's longest-running sustaining theater and is a not-for-profit, all-volunteer, membership organization with federal and state tax exempt status.  We are a registered New York State charity, making all donations tax-deductible.
